WebUse a vacuum sealed bag to keep the dill fresher longer. Store dried dill in a dark, cool, dry place. Use within about 1 year. Direct a fan, set on low, into the oven to increase airflow. If drying dill seeds, place in an oven preheated to 120 degrees Fahrenheit. Dry for about 4 to 6 hours. Sprinkle dill flowers over potatoes, fish, coleslaw ... Web12 de abr. de 2024 · 2.2 lb. WebSoak the plucked weeds with water, and rinse. Wipe the weeds with a clean kitchen towel to dry them. Preheat the oven to a temperature of 110ºF. Place the dill on a baking sheet (covered with parchment paper) in the oven. Keep the weed in the oven for about 3 – 4 hours. WebWays of drying dill at home. in the oven; in the microwave; in the electric dryer; on the windowsill; in the fresh air.Drying greens in the oven.Preheat the oven to 40 ° C. Cover the baking sheet with a parchment sheet and freely spread the greens on the surface of the paper. Place the pan in the oven.Slightly open the oven door to steam out.
